Chimichurri Burger

The Chimichurri Burger is a flavorful choice that provides a solid amount of protein, important for muscle maintenance. It has a moderate calorie level with a balanced fat content including some saturated fats. This burger supplies essential minerals like iron and calcium, which support overall health. With B vitamins and vitamin C, it helps promote metabolism and immune function.

Macronutrient distribution

A Serving (240 g) of Chimichurri Burger contains 400 calories, 30 g of protein, 35 g of carbohydrates, and 18 g of fat.
